Discovering Phuket: Fun Facts and Travel Tips

Phuket is a popular tourist destination located in the southern part of Thailand. It is the largest island in Thailand, and it is known for its stunning beaches, crystal-clear waters, and vibrant nightlife. But there is more to Phuket than just its beautiful beaches. Here are some fun facts about Phuket: - Phuket is home to the Big Buddha, a 45-meter tall statue that sits on top of a hill and offers stunning views of the island. - Phuket was once a major trading hub for tin and rubber, and you can still see the remnants of its mining past in the form of abandoned mines and factories. - Phuket is home to the famous Phi Phi Islands, which were used as a filming location for the movie "The Beach" starring Leonardo DiCaprio. - Phuket is one of the few places in Thailand where you can still see traditional Sino-Portuguese architecture. If you're planning a trip to Phuket, here are some travel tips to keep in mind: - The official language of Thailand is Thai, but many locals in Phuket speak English, especially in tourist areas. - The currency in Thailand is the Thai baht, and you can exchange your money at banks, exchange booths, or ATMs. - Tipping is not expected in Thailand, but it is appreciated, especially in restaurants and for tour guides. - Phuket can get very crowded during peak season (November to February), so if you want to avoid the crowds, consider visiting during the shoulder season (March to May or September to October).

How to Travel to Phuket: A Complete Guide

Phuket is easily accessible by air, land, and sea. Here's a complete guide on how to get to Phuket: - By air: Phuket has its own international airport (HKT), which is serviced by many airlines from around the world. From the airport, you can take a taxi or shuttle bus to your hotel. - By land: Phuket is connected to the mainland by a bridge, and you can drive or take a bus from Bangkok or other major cities in Thailand. The journey takes around 12 hours by bus. - By sea: Phuket is a popular destination for cruises, and there are many cruise lines that stop in Phuket. You can also take a ferry from nearby islands like Phi Phi or Krabi.

The Best Time to Visit Phuket: Weather, Festivals, and More

The best time to visit Phuket depends on what you're looking for. Here's a breakdown of the weather, festivals, and crowds throughout the year: - Peak season (November to February): This is the busiest time of year in Phuket, and it's when the weather is at its best. Expect crowds, higher prices, and a lively atmosphere. - Shoulder season (March to May or September to October): This is a great time to visit if you want to avoid the crowds. The weather is still good, and prices are lower than during peak season. - Low season (June to August): This is the rainy season in Phuket, but it's still a good time to visit if you don't mind the occasional downpour. Prices are lower, and crowds are smaller. - Festivals: Phuket has several festivals throughout the year, including the Vegetarian Festival in October and the Songkran Festival in April.

Where to Stay in Phuket: A Guide to the Best Neighborhoods

Phuket has many neighborhoods to choose from, each with its own unique vibe. Here's a guide to the best neighborhoods in Phuket: - Patong: Patong is the most popular neighborhood in Phuket, and it's known for its lively nightlife and beautiful beach. It's a great place to stay if you want to be in the center of the action. - Kata: Kata is a quieter neighborhood than Patong, but it still has plenty of restaurants, bars, and shops. It's a great place to stay if you want to be close to the beach but away from the crowds. - Karon: Karon is a family-friendly neighborhood with a long, sandy beach. It's a great place to stay if you want a more laid-back atmosphere. - Old Town: Phuket's old town is filled with Sino-Portuguese architecture, colorful buildings, and street art. It's a great place to stay if you want to immerse yourself in Phuket's history and culture.

What to Eat in Phuket: A Foodie's Guide to Local Cuisine

Thai cuisine is known for its delicious flavors, and Phuket is no exception. Here are some local dishes to try in Phuket: - Tom yum goong: This is a spicy and sour soup made with shrimp, lemongrass, and chili. - Pad Thai: This is a stir-fried noodle dish with vegetables, egg, and your choice of meat or seafood. - Massaman curry: This is a mild and creamy curry made with potatoes, peanuts, and your choice of meat or seafood. - Som tam: This is a spicy and sour salad made with green papaya, tomatoes, and chili. - Khao man gai: This is a simple but delicious dish made with boiled chicken, rice, and a flavorful sauce. - Roti: This is a sweet or savory flatbread that is often served as a snack or dessert.

How to Travel Around Phuket

Phuket has several transportation options to help you get around the island: - Taxis: Taxis are available throughout Phuket, but they can be expensive. Make sure to negotiate the price before getting in. - Tuk-tuks: Tuk-tuks are a fun and inexpensive way to get around, but make sure to negotiate the price before getting in. - Songthaews: Songthaews are shared taxis that follow a fixed route. They are a cheap and convenient way to get around. - Motorbike rental: Motorbikes are a popular way to get around Phuket, but make sure to wear a helmet and drive safely. - Bicycle rental: Bicycles are a great way to explore Phuket at your own pace, and they're environmentally friendly too.
